How do you calibrate compound gauges?

To calibrate compound gauges, you will need a calibration pump and a pressure calibrator. Connect the compound gauge to the calibration pump and apply pressure using the pressure calibrator. Compare the readings on the compound gauge with the readings on the pressure calibrator and make necessary adjustments to bring them into alignment.


Discuss the possible variations that would affect pressure if hot fluid is used in a pressure calibrator?

Using hot fluid in a pressure calibrator can lead to variations in pressure due to the thermal expansion of the fluid, changes in the viscosity of the fluid, and potential thermal drift in the calibration equipment. It is important to consider and compensate for these variations to ensure accurate pressure measurements.

Difference between calibrator control and standard?

A calibrator is used to calibrate instruments by adjusting their settings, while a control is used to monitor and maintain a certain condition or value. A standard is a reference point or measurement used for comparison to evaluate the accuracy and quality of results.


What is Sand bath temperature calibrator?

A sand bath temperature calibrator is a high precision temperature controlled fluidized sand bath instrument designed to analyze the performance of other temperature control or temperature indicating instruments. Due to its high precision it can be used as a standard for calibrating other temperature control or indicating instruments.
